Sealing - In addition to filling and degassing, you will also need vacuum to seal the lithium-ion batteries. Vacuum removes moisture, air, and any impurities in the battery before packing. You will notice that lithium-ion batteries have plastic wraps packed tightly around them. This is done using vacuum pumps.
The lifespan of a Li-ion battery pack varies based on factors like usage, charging habits, and environmental conditions. Typically, they last around 2,000 to 3,000 charge cycles or roughly 5 to 10 years before experiencing significant capacity loss. How do you charge a lithium-ion battery pack?
Lithium metal batteries contained in equipment meeting the provisions of Section II of Packing Instruction 970 of the IATA Regulations. No more than four cells or two batteries may be mailed in any single package. Lithium battery mark labels are not required for packages that contain no more than four cells or two batteries contained in devices.
